This book was first published in 2009. When William Thackeray,
Charles Dickens and Elizabeth Gaskell began their writing careers
in the 1830s, they chose to write literary sketches, adopting a
popular short form that emphasized description and essayistic
analysis rather than storytelling. In this unusual study of a
previously neglected literary form, Amanpal Garcha shows how the
literary sketch influenced these authors' careers, transformed the
marketplace for fiction and led to the development of some of the
Victorian novel's key formal and ideological elements.
